Key Factors Influencing Tile Pricing: An In-Depth Analysis
Assessing Material Composition for Superior Durability
<a href=”https://writebuff.com/choosing-the-perfect-tiles-for-your-new-bathroom-guide/”>Porcelain tiles</a> are highly regarded for their remarkable density, reduced porosity, and outstanding durability when compared to conventional ceramic tiles. Made from finer types of clay and subjected to higher firing temperatures, porcelain tiles demonstrate enhanced strength, which is typically reflected in their elevated price point.
In bathroom environments, where exposure to moisture and long-term durability are critical, investing in porcelain tiles often proves to be a wise choice. However, it's important to note that ceramic tiles have significantly progressed in quality in recent years, presenting affordable alternatives that are well-suited for walls and areas experiencing lower foot traffic.
Understanding the Impact of Manufacturing Processes on Tile Quality and Pricing
The overall quality of tiles is shaped by more than just their material composition; the manufacturing processes also play a pivotal role in defining their characteristics.
Single-fired tiles are generally less expensive but may show quality inconsistencies across different batches. In contrast, double-fired tiles offer richer finishes, a broader spectrum of vibrant colours, and enhanced durability, making them a worthwhile investment for discerning homeowners seeking high-quality renovations.
Tiles featuring rectified edges are meticulously cut using advanced machinery to ensure uniformity in dimensions and shape. Although these tiles tend to be priced higher, they allow for minimal grout lines, resulting in a seamless and contemporary aesthetic that is highly desirable in modern bathroom designs.
The Significance of Tile Thickness for Structural Integrity and Durability
When considering tile selection, it is essential to understand that tiles intended for flooring applications must possess greater thickness and sturdiness compared to those designed for wall installations.
For example, wall tiles typically range from 6 to 8mm in thickness, while floor tiles usually measure between 8 and 12mm.

Investing in thick, robust tiles when wall coverage is the only requirement can lead to unnecessary financial strain. It is essential to match the tile thickness with the intended installation area to optimise your budget effectively.

Effective Strategies for Maximising Your Tile Budget
By making thoughtful and informed choices, you can achieve an elegant bathroom appearance without straining your finances. Below are several practical strategies to optimise your tile expenditure.
Combine Premium and Standard Tiles for a Balanced Aesthetic:
Incorporate luxurious feature tiles on a focal wall or within a designated niche, while opting for more affordable tiles in less visible areas, ensuring a harmonious blend of elegance and cost-effectiveness.
Choose Larger Format Tiles for Efficiency:
Larger tiles, such as those measuring 600x600mm, cover a larger surface area with fewer grout lines, creating an illusion of spaciousness in smaller bathrooms while also reducing labour costs associated with installation.
Stick with Standard Sizes to Save Costs:
Choosing non-standard tile sizes can significantly increase both purchase and installation costs. Opting for standard sizes will ensure maximum savings and ease of installation.
Capitalize on Clearance or End-of-Run Stock for Savings:
High-quality tiles are often available at discounted prices towards the end of production runs. Acquiring discontinued tiles can result in substantial savings; however, ensure to purchase an additional 10–15% for future maintenance and repairs.
Prioritise Durable Tiles for Floors and High-Traffic Zones:
Allocate a larger portion of your budget towards tiles designed for flooring and wet areas, where durability is crucial, while opting for cost-effective alternatives in dry or low-traffic spaces to enhance overall value.
Recognising Quality Variations in Bathroom Tiles
While many bathroom tiles may appear similar at first glance, significant differences can exist beneath the surface that can greatly impact the success of your renovation.
Consistency of Shade for Aesthetic Harmony:
Inexpensive tiles often display inconsistencies in colour across production batches. Always verify batch numbers before making a purchase to avoid mismatches that could detract from the aesthetic appeal of your space.
Quality of Glazing for Longevity:
Poor-quality glazes can chip and stain more easily. High-quality glazing is resistant to scratching and absorbs less moisture, which is particularly critical in wet areas like showers and baths.
Porosity Levels for Structural Integrity:
Tiles with high porosity can lead to water ingress and cracking over time, a common issue associated with lower-cost ceramics. Ensuring low porosity is essential for maintaining the integrity and longevity of your bathroom.
Slip Resistance Ratings for Safety Assurance:
Bathroom floor tiles should meet or exceed an R10 slip resistance rating according to Australian standards to ensure safety in wet conditions and prevent accidents.
Neglecting to assess these factors can transform what appears to be a straightforward tile choice into a costly repair and replacement scenario.
Understanding the Financial Implications of Grout Selection in Your Bathroom
While the choice of tiles establishes the overall aesthetic for your bathroom, the selection of grout is equally important, as it significantly affects durability, visual appeal, and maintenance requirements.
Assessing Grout Costs and Material Options for Your Bathroom
Standard Budget Grout for Cost Efficiency:
Traditional cement-based grouts are economical and suitable for low-moisture environments. However, they are porous and can become discoloured or crack over time, especially in showers and high-traffic bathrooms.
Premium Grout Alternatives for Longevity:
Epoxy-based grouts or those modified with polymers resist stains, cracking, and moisture absorption. Although their initial costs are higher, they often provide long-term savings by reducing maintenance and repair needs.
Premium grout options also offer vibrant, enduring colours that maintain their brilliance even with daily use.
The Influence of Tile Size on Grout Expenses in Your Renovation
Smaller tiles require a greater quantity of grout, affecting both material and labour costs associated with installation.

- Large-format tiles (600x600mm or larger) minimise grout lines, leading to reduced material and labour costs overall.
If you choose smaller tiles for aesthetic appeal (such as penny rounds or subway patterns), ensure to allocate budget for premium grout. The prominence of grout lines accentuates the necessity for a durable, stain-resistant product to uphold the integrity of your design.
